Vulnerability Description
SQL injection vulnerability in voircom.php in LulieBlog 1.02 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the id parameter.

What is CVE-2008-0446?
CVE-2008-0446 is a vulnerability with a CVSS score of 7.5 (HIGH). SQL injection vulnerability in voircom.php in LulieBlog 1.02 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the id parameter.
